Focusing on the environmental and economic ramifications of fish diseases, this work examines their impact on freshwater fish and the efficiency of fish production farms. It highlights the negative effects of fish diseases on ecosystems and underscores the significant economic losses faced by the aquaculture industry, which has global trade implications. Additionally, the study addresses the ongoing issues of aquatic pollution, linking it to the health of aquatic animals and increased mortality rates.
